Cost-Effective Theraputics

Technology Partners has a long history of investing in cost-effective therapeutics dating back to our first investment in Ventritex in 1986. Cost pressures on the healthcare system will accelerate as baby boomers hit their peak healthcare consumption years. Therefore, effective therapeutic products that can replace costly services and procedures will continue to be a compelling area in which to invest.
